6203 vaccinated in state till Feb 4

A total of 179 beneficiaries were vaccinated in Dimapur, Mokokchung, Wokha and Peren on Thursday by Covishield vaccine taking the total vaccinated tally to 6203 in the state. 

In a press release, state immunization officer (UPI) Dr. Ritu Thurr said that a total of 44 frontline workers other than the healthcare workers have been vaccinated in Peren and Phek. Dr.Thurr said that no adverse events have been reported that needed medical intervention till date. 

Nearly 4.5 million (44,49,552) beneficiaries have received COVID-19 vaccine shots in merely 19 days, the Union Health Ministry said on Thursday. 

In a span of 24 hours, 3,10,604 people were vaccinated across 8,041 sessions, it said.
